Output 8faebd19c766a75e955d7cfb54801f85ebcee2421b4e29d8a993bace9f2b30a5:1

value
3180659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d780182dab524b43aa1a07b849edcd6db607254d OP_EQUAL
address
3MLUewntUZLRce8C87HMi1q8CJuEYSq3gY
transaction
8faebd19c766a75e955d7cfb54801f85ebcee2421b4e29d8a993bace9f2b30a5
spent
true